City Guides in the Travel Community: Travel Guidebooks

City guides play a pivotal role in the travel community, providing valuable information and insights for travelers seeking to explore new destinations. These guidebooks serve as comprehensive resources, offering detailed descriptions of local attractions, restaurants, accommodations, transportation options, and other essential aspects of city life. By equipping travelers with pertinent knowledge about their chosen destination, these guides enable them to make informed decisions and enhance their overall travel experience. For instance, imagine a traveler planning a trip to London who is unsure about which neighborhoods to visit or where to find authentic British cuisine. A reliable city guidebook would offer recommendations on must-see sights such as the Tower of London or Buckingham Palace while also suggesting lesser-known areas like Camden Town or Shoreditch that are renowned for their vibrant street art scenes.
In recent years, traditional print versions of city guidebooks have faced competition from digital alternatives such as online platforms and mobile applications. However, despite the rise of technology-driven solutions, travel guidebooks continue to hold significant value within the travel community. One key advantage offered by physical guidebooks is their portability – they can be easily carried around during travels without concerns about battery life or internet connectivity. Moreover, many avid travelers appreciate the tactile nature of flipping through pages and making handwritten notes in guide books, which adds a personal touch to their travel planning process.
Another advantage of city guidebooks is the curated and expertly researched content they provide. Most reputable guidebook publishers have teams of experienced writers and researchers who spend extensive time exploring each destination and gathering up-to-date information. This ensures that the recommendations and insights provided in these guidebooks are reliable and accurate. Travelers can trust that the information they find within these pages has been thoroughly vetted, saving them from potential disappointments or inconveniences during their trip.
Furthermore, city guidebooks often include useful maps, diagrams, and illustrations that aid travelers in navigating unfamiliar cities. These visual aids can be particularly helpful when trying to understand complex transportation systems or finding specific points of interest. Additionally, many guidebooks offer practical tips for local customs, etiquette, safety precautions, and language basics. Such information can be invaluable for travelers who want to immerse themselves in the local culture and avoid any cultural faux pas.

The Evolution of City Guides
As travelers seek to navigate unfamiliar cities and make the most of their experiences, city guides have become indispensable tools. Over time, these guides have evolved significantly in response to changing technologies and shifting travel trends. One example that exemplifies this evolution is the transition from traditional printed guidebooks to digital resources.
In the past, printed guidebooks were the primary source of information for travelers exploring new cities. These books provided detailed maps, recommendations on accommodations and dining options, historical background on landmarks, and practical tips for navigating local transportation systems. However, with the advent of smartphones and internet connectivity, digital city guides emerged as a more convenient alternative.
- Increased Accessibility: Digital city guides are accessible anytime and anywhere through mobile applications or websites. Travelers no longer need to carry bulky guidebooks but can simply access all necessary information using their smartphones.
- Real-Time Updates: Unlike printed guidebooks which become outdated quickly due to changes in establishments or attractions, digital city guides can provide real-time updates on opening hours, closures, events, and promotions.
- Interactive Features: Digital city guides often offer interactive features such as user-generated reviews and ratings that allow travelers to benefit from others’ experiences. This creates a sense of community within the travel community.
- Customization Options: With digital city guides, travelers can personalize their itineraries based on their interests and preferences by bookmarking favorite places or creating custom lists.

First and foremost, familiarize yourself with the layout and organization of the city guidebook before you embark on your trip. Take some time to skim through the table of contents and index, noting key sections such as maps, attractions, dining recommendations, and practical information like transportation options or emergency contacts. By having a grasp of its structure, you can easily locate relevant details when needed.
Next, take advantage of any additional features provided in the city guidebook. Some guides offer downloadable mobile apps or companion websites that enhance your experience by providing real-time updates or interactive maps. In our example case study, Sarah finds that her chosen guide includes QR codes alongside attraction descriptions which lead to audio tours – allowing her to delve deeper into each site’s history while exploring at her own pace.
To further enhance your overall experience using city guides, consider incorporating these strategies:
- Prioritize highlights: Begin by focusing on must-see attractions recommended by reliable sources within the guidebook.
- Seek local insights: Look for hidden gems suggested by locals or fellow travelers within forums or user-generated content sections.
- Customize itineraries: Utilize sample itineraries provided in the guidebook as templates but personalize them according to your interests and preferences.
- Keep notes and annotations: Jot down personal observations or add sticky notes directly within your guidebook for future reference.
